Open your PDF file using Adobe Acrobat. Click "Tools," select "Content" and choose "Edit Document Text." Drag the mouse across and select the text you want to replace. Type the replacement text.

Removing text from a PDF isn't as easy as drawing a black bar across it. Fortunately, redaction tools let you truly erase sensitive text in Preview, Adobe Acrobat DC Pro, and PDFPen.
